About J. Peracaula
J. Peracaula is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ering, Automotive Engineering, Artificial Intelligence and Electronic, Optical and Magnetic Materials, having authored 28 papers that have together received 363 indexed citations. Recurring topics across this work include Multilevel Inverters and Converters (14 papers), Sensorless Control of Electric Motors (13 papers), Advanced DC-DC Converters (12 papers), Electric Motor Design and Analysis (8 papers), Microgrid Control and Optimization (6 papers), Magnetic Bearings and Levitation Dynamics (4 papers), Power Quality and Harmonics (3 papers) and Wireless Power Transfer Systems (3 papers). The work is most often cited by research in Control and Systems Engineering (150 citations), Electrical and Electronic Engineering (348 citations), Energy Engineering and Power Technology (11 citations), Automotive Engineering (20 citations) and Renewable Energy, Sustainability and the Environment (23 citations). J. Peracaula has collaborated with scholars based in Spain, Ukraine and Mexico. Frequent co-authors include J. Bordonau, Salvador Alepuz, Sergio Busquets‐Monge, A. Gilabert, P.J. Costa Branco and José Rodellar. Their work appears in journals such as Mathematics and Computers in Simulation, Electronics Letters, IEEE Transactions on Power Electronics and Proceedings of 6th International Fuzzy Systems Conference.
